Toburen v. State Farm Mutual Automobile Insurance Company
Plaintiff: Kelsa Toburen
Defendant: State Farm Mutual Automobile Insurance Company
Case Number: 3:2017cv00955
Filed: August 21, 2017
Court: U.S. District Court for the Middle District of Florida
Office: Jacksonville Office
County: Duval
Presiding Judge: Marcia Morales Howard
Presiding Judge: James R. Klindt
Nature of Suit: Motor Vehicle
Cause of Action: 28 U.S.C. ยง 1332
Jury Demanded By: Both

October 13, 2017 Opinion or Order Filing 17 ORDER granting 4 Defendant State Farm Mutual Automobile Insurance Company's Motion to Dismiss, Without Prejudice, or, Alternatively to Abate Count II of the Complaint. Count II is dismissed without prejudice. Signed by Judge Marcia Morales Howard on 10/13/2017. (JW)
